... unless it forms any basis for a warranty claim, including goodwill, where failure to return the offending item to MB means the dealer has to foot the entire bill. A pain in the butt for the dealer esp. if they didn't sell the car originally.
Luckily this new procedure has put a stop to the old main dealer method of changing everything under warranty without a proper diagnostic and crossing their fingers.
Mercedes did try a new idea where we'd try to diagnose a problem over the phone, and order everything to cure it. Anything not used we could send back under this 'Fixed First Visit' scheme. Control units and anything obscure weren't covered, unfortunately it was wide open to abuse and most dealers just cleared all the cr@p off their shelves after the dust was blown off.
